Deadline extended for Gloucester School Board vacancy

The Gloucester County School Board has extended its deadline for applications for the York District board seat being vacated by Carla Hook to May 31. Hook has said she will vacate the seat on June 15.

Applicants must be registered York District voters. They should submit letters of interest, including a statement of qualifications, along with letters of support from registered York District voters, to board clerk Carol Dehoux at 6099 T.C. Walker Road, Gloucester, Va. 23061.

Applicants will be given the opportunity to address the school board for up to 10 minutes during its June 13 meeting. They may also introduce up to two York District supporters who will be permitted to speak on their behalf for up to five minutes.

The board will interview applicants on June 22 in a closed session beginning at 5:30 p.m. and is expected to make an appointment to the seat during its work session that evening. The appointment is for a term that begins July 5 and ends Dec. 31.
